Vanessa Benavente Talks ‘The Chosen: Last Supper’

In this exclusive interview for The Chosen, actress Vanessa Benavente opens up about her transformative journey portraying Mother Mary in the series. In this interview, Vanessa talks about acting, faith, and humanity.

As the show continues to captivate audiences worldwide with its heartfelt storytelling and cinematic depth of biblical stories, Vanessa offers an intimate look into the emotional and spiritual layers required to bring such an iconic figure to life. In our conversation, she reflects on the preparation, discipline, and vulnerability it took to embody Mary’s strength and grace — especially as The Chosen enters its pivotal Season 5 and looks ahead to Season 6. From exploring the quiet resilience of motherhood to interpreting the layers of emotional depth and faith within the narrative, Vanessa shares how her own experiences informed her portrayal and deepened her connection to the role. She even shares a particular day on set that challenged her as an actress.

Viewers can expect thoughtful insights into her creative process, behind-the-scenes stories from set, and a preview of what’s to come. Whether you’re a longtime fan of The Chosen or new to its world, Vanessa’s reflections shed light on the artistry and faith that make her performance as Mother Mary so compelling.
